The Black Bay celebrates 60 years of diving watches with extraordinary heritage. The iconic model inherits the general lines, as well as the domed dial and crystal from the first Tudor diving watches. It borrows the characteristic angular hands, known as snowflake, from the watches delivered in large quantities to the French National Navy in the 1970s.
Offering a sporty yet sophisticated look, this Tudor Black Bay Watch showcases a bold blue dial and unidirectional rotatable bezel in steel with 60-minute graduated disc in matt blue anodised aluminium and silver gilded markings and numerals.
Presented within a 39mm stainless steel case, the dial is powered by a self-winding mechanical movement with bidirectional rotor system. This watch is also water resistant to 200 metres.
Features include
Reference number: 79030B
Case: 39mm 316L steel case with polished and satin finish
Thickness: 11.9mm
Bezel: Unidirectional rotatable bezel in steel with 60-minute graduated disc
Crown: Steel screw-down winding crown
Dial: Blue, domed
Crystal: Domed sapphire crystal
Water Resistance: 200 metres (660 ft)
Bracelet: Black fabric strap
Calibre: Manufacture Calibre MT5402 (COSC)
Functions: Hours, minutes, seconds (Stop-seconds for precise time setting)
Power Reserve: Approx. 70 hours
Winding: Automatic
Jewels: 27
Frequency: 28,800 beats/hour (4Hz)
